DB2裸设备及表空间调整指南
DB2裸设备及表空间调整知识解析####一、DB2裸设备概述在DB2数据库系统中,裸设备是一种特殊的存储设备,它直接与操作系统中的物理磁盘关联,而不通过文件系统进行格式化。裸设备可以提高数据访问速度,并减少文件系统的开销,因此在需要高性能的应用场景中被广泛采用。 ####二、裸设备列表及其属性给定文件中列出了一个DB2环境中多个裸设备的信息,包括设备名称、容量、逻辑卷类型以及位置。这些裸设备主要服务于不同的数据库表空间需求: - 设备名称:如
相关推荐
DB2表空间管理与应用
DB2 的表空间功能可以说是核心的。简单来说,它就是数据库用来管理物理存储的一个容器。你可以把它看作是数据库里的“文件夹”,它把表、索引等数据存储在不同的“文件夹”中,方便管理。你也能根据需要调整它的大小、性能等。最常见的几种表空间类型有:系统表空间、用户表空间、大对象表空间等。举个例子,如果你想存储图片或文档,可以选择大对象表空间。
创建表空间其实挺,只需要在 DB2 中执行类似这种 SQL 语句:
CREATE TABLESPACE mytablespace MANAGED BY AUTOMATIC STORAGE USING DEFAULT EXTENT SIZE 1000 DATA B
DB2
0
2025-06-12
DB2表空间与区段管理资料
DB2 中的表空间和区段(Extents)管理其实挺重要的,尤其是在大数据量时。你得知道,区段其实就是数据库管理程序在用完一个容器的页数后,开始用下一个容器。这里的ExtentSize决定了每个区段的大小,默认 32 页,但你可以根据实际需要调整,比如 OLTP 用 16 页,仓库用 64 页。每个表空间的EXTENTSIZE可以设置得不一样,且一旦定义后无法修改。所以,合理设置这些参数关键,避免后期的性能瓶颈。建议了解下tDFT_Extent_SZ参数,它能帮你在数据库级别设置块大小。如果你刚接触 DB2,最好看看一些相关文章,你更好理解表空间和区段的配置。比如DB2 表空间和缓冲池详解,可
DB2
0
2025-06-10
DB2表空间管理命令基础培训
DB2 的表空间管理挺有意思的,多人刚接触时会觉得有点复杂,但其实掌握了几条常用的命令后,就能轻松搞定。比如,List tablespaces命令可以显示所有表空间的状态,List tablespace containers则能列出某个表空间的所有容器情况。要增加容器或调整表空间大小时,Alter tablespace命令就派上用场了。就像 DMS 一样,也能方便地增加容器大小。而且,表空间的参数调节也蛮方便的,可以调整如PREFETCHSIZE、OVERHEAD和TRANSFERRATE等参数来提升性能。对于表空间的删除,你可以通过Drop tablespace命令快速清理掉不需要的表空间。
DB2
0
2025-06-24
DB2数据库表空间的日常维护指南
查看表空间信息可以通过命令list tablespaces show detail进行。要查看特定表空间的容器信息,可使用命令list tablespace containers for 1。在创建新表空间时,需使用create tablespace命令,并确保定义管理方式和文件路径。要删除表空间及其中所有表,请使用drop tablespace命令。要增加表空间的容器大小,可通过alter tablespace命令添加新容器或扩展已有容器的大小。
DB2
14
2024-08-18
DMS示例创建表空间-DB2基础培训
创建表空间sms来管理数据库文件,容器定义为文件 '/database/dms/data.1' 和设备 '/dev/rlv1'。
DB2
12
2024-05-15
DB2数据库表空间管理详解
DB2表空间管理是使用DB2数据库系统时必须掌握的关键概念。表空间在数据库中负责数据的逻辑组织和存储管理,有效地分隔表和相关存储元素,提升数据管理效率。DB2中的表空间分为系统管理空间(SMS)和数据库管理空间(DMS)两种类型,分别依赖于操作系统自动管理和数据库手动管理。不同类型的表空间包括规则表空间、系统目录表空间和临时表空间,用途各有不同。详细的创建和管理命令使管理员能够根据需求灵活配置表空间,确保数据库的稳定性和性能优化。
DB2
13
2024-08-13
DB2表空间和缓冲池详解
深入解析DB2中的表空间和缓冲池,了解它们在数据管理中的重要作用。
DB2
16
2024-04-30
DB2表空间的检查与优化策略
DB2表空间的检查与优化是数据库管理中关键的任务之一。在数据库运行过程中,通过附录1中的DB2表空间状态列表,可以详细了解各表空间的当前状态和性能特征。
DB2
20
2024-07-13
DB2表操作实战指南
DB2 表操作涉及的知识点挺多,但其实掌握了几个关键步骤后,使用起来就蛮顺手的。你需要切换到 DB2 实例用户,启动实例,连接数据库,接下来就可以开始导出、导入数据,甚至清空数据啦。多操作都能通过命令行完成,比如导出表结构、表数据,甚至是清除数据或者更新。别忘了,表空间的查看和管理也重要,尤其是在资源紧张时,增加表空间是个不错的选择。数据时也有些小细节,比如字符问题影响导入导出,要注意。整个操作过程中,建议做好备份,以防万一,另外,锁表问题也常常让人头疼,记得定期检查并锁定情况。
DB2
0
2025-06-15